The web management interface for Mitel 3300 Integrated Communications Platform (ICP) before 4.2.2.11 allows remote authenticated users to cause a denial of service (resource exhaustion) via a large number of active sessions, which exceeds ICP's maximum.

CVE-2004-0945 is classified as a denial of service vulnerability due to resource exhaustion.
To mitigate CVE-2004-0945, update the Mitel 3300 Integrated Communications Platform to version 4.2.2.11 or later.
CVE-2004-0945 affects the web management interface of the Mitel 3300 Integrated Communications Platform.
Remote authenticated users can exploit CVE-2004-0945 to cause denial of service on affected systems.
Yes, CVE-2004-0945 can be exploited easily by sending a large number of active session requests.
